About ‘Futuristic City in the Largest Reflecting Pool’ by JAN HILLOV
The original black-and-white drawing from 1968 has been brought to life using artificial intelligence, resulting in this captivating cityscape with futuristic architecture reflected on calm water – an exceptionally large reflecting pool. The scene features complex geometric structures beneath a dramatic sky.
